Main Page
Class List
Class Index
Class Hierarchy
Class Members
All
Classes
Functions
Variables
Typedefs
Friends
Pages
Api
ICardTicketBuilder.h
1
//------------------------------------------------------------------------------
2
//
3
// Copyright (c) 2015 Glympse Inc. All rights reserved.
4
//
5
//------------------------------------------------------------------------------
6
7
#ifndef ICARDTICKETBUILDER_H__GLYMPSE__
8
#define ICARDTICKETBUILDER_H__GLYMPSE__
9
10
namespace
Glympse
11
{
12
16
/*O*public**/
struct
ICardTicketBuilder
:
public
virtual
ICommon
17
{
23
public
:
virtual
void
setTicket
(
const
GTicket
& ticket) = 0;
24
31
public
:
virtual
void
addCardMember
(
const
GCardMember
& member) = 0;
32
39
public
:
virtual
void
setReference
(
const
GString
& reference) = 0;
40
44
public
:
virtual
GCardTicket
getCardTicket
() = 0;
45
};
46
47
/*C*/
typedef
O< ICardTicketBuilder >
GCardTicketBuilder
;
48
49
}
50
51
#endif // !ICARDTICKETBUILDER_H__GLYMPSE__
Generated on Tue Jun 26 2018 08:46:46 by
1.8.4